
Expert Advice: 3 Things to Avoid During a Child's Meltdown
Parenting During Meltdowns: Expert Tips to Stay Calm and Support Your Child Parents often struggle with how to best respond when their child experiences a meltdown. A recent TikTok video by Board Certified Behavior Analyst, Amanda, M.Ed, BCBA, LBA (@bcba_amanda), offers three key strategies to help parents navigate these challenging moments more effectively. Amanda emphasizes the importance of avoiding unnecessary demands during a meltdown. "Telling your child to 'look at me' or 'come here' when they're already upset is not going to be productive," she explains. This approach can escalate the situation and create a power struggle. She also cautions against punishing a child's feelings. Statements like, "That's not a big deal," or "Don't be such a crybaby," are counterproductive. "It tells them they shouldn't be feeling this way and actually punishes them for having human emotions," Amanda points out. Finally, Amanda stresses the importance of parents staying calm and neutral during a crisis. "You can just stay quiet during these hard moments," she advises. Maintaining composure helps regulate the situation and provides a sense of stability for the child.
